Internship Machine Learning Engineer information

What does an internship machine learning engineer do?

An Internship Machine Learning Engineer works alongside experienced engineers to help develop, test, and deploy machine learning models. Their responsibilities may include cleaning and preparing data, writing code for model training, evaluating model performance, and contributing to research tasks. Interns often learn to use popular frameworks such as TensorFlow or PyTorch and gain hands-on experience with real-world datasets. This role is designed to help students or recent graduates apply their academic knowledge to practical problems while developing industry-relevant skills.

What is the difference between Internship Machine Learning Engineer vs Data Scientist Intern?

AspectInternship Machine Learning EngineerData Scientist Intern
Required CredentialsBasic programming, introductory ML knowledgeStatistics, data analysis, programming
Work EnvironmentDeveloping ML models, coding, testingData analysis, visualization, reporting
Employer & Industry UsageTech companies, startups, AI firmsTech, finance, healthcare, consulting

Internship Machine Learning Engineers focus on developing and testing machine learning models, often requiring programming and basic ML knowledge. Data Scientist Interns analyze data, create visualizations, and generate insights. Both roles are common in tech and data-driven industries, but ML Engineer internships emphasize model deployment, while Data Science internships focus on data analysis and reporting.

What types of projects and responsibilities can I expect as an internship machine learning engineer?

As an Internship Machine Learning Engineer, you will typically support the development, testing, and deployment of machine learning models under the guidance of senior engineers. Your responsibilities may include data preprocessing, exploratory data analysis, implementing algorithms, and evaluating model performance. You'll often collaborate closely with data scientists, software engineers, and product managers, gaining exposure to real-world workflows and tools. This hands-on experience is invaluable for building technical skills and understanding how machine learning solutions are integrated into larger products.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an internship machine learning engineer, and why are they important?

To excel as an Internship Machine Learning Engineer, you typically need a solid background in mathematics, programming (especially Python), and foundational machine learning concepts, often supported by coursework or relevant project experience. Familiarity with tools such as TensorFlow, PyTorch, scikit-learn, and version control systems like Git is common, along with proficiency in data processing libraries. Curiosity, strong problem-solving abilities, and effective teamwork and communication skills help set candidates apart. These competencies ensure you can contribute meaningfully to projects, adapt to new challenges, and collaborate productively in a rapidly evolving technical environment.
